专栏名称: 面包板社区
面包板社区——中国第一电子人社交平台 面包板社区是Aspencore旗下媒体,整合了电子工程专辑、电子技术设计、国际电子商情丰富资源。社区包括论坛、博客、问答,拥有超过250万注册用户,加入面包板社区,从菜鸟变大神,打造您的电子人脉社交圈!
今天看啥  ›  专栏  ›  面包板社区

差分输入ADC的单端到差分转换器驱动设计

面包板社区  · 公众号  ·  · 2024-05-28 17:05
    

文章预览

单端信号需要转换成差分信号,以便使用ADC进行转换。这个就所谓的ADC驱动电路。 需要的结果为 Vp = Vcm + Vi/2 Vn = Vcm – Vi/2 这样 Vp – Vn = Vi 使用简单的加法器和减法器完成这个功能。电路中Vcm = 2.5V 可以求得 Vp = Vcm+Vi Vn = Vcm-Vi 得到的结果差分信号为输入信号的2倍,实现单端到差分的转换。上述结论需要信号源输入阻抗为0。因此对于输出阻抗较高的传感器是不适用的。另外需要使用多个匹配度较好的电阻,否则会产生误差。 考虑简化一下,使用下面的电路。 Vp = Vi Vn = 2*Vcm – Vi 如果令Vp = Vcm+Vi,则可以得到 Vn = Vcm – Vi。 由 Vp – Vn = -2*Vcm+2*Vi 可以看出,差分输出的结果实际上是输入信号的2倍再减去 2倍Vcm。 当然完全没有必要再增加电路处理这个2倍Vcm,可以将AD转换后进行数字处理。如果需要处理负输入信号,这个电路需要使用正负电源供电。如果 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照
总结与预览地址:访问总结与预览